										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Supreme Court of India will hear a batch of petitions challenging the parole of eleven convicts in the Bilkis Bano gangrape case on March 27.The court constituted a new panel consisting of Justices KM Joseph and BV Nagarathna to hear Bano&#8217;s writ petition and the pleas of several political and civil rights activists involved in the case.</p>
<p>This decision was made after the Chief Justice of India, DY Chandrachud, on March 22 ordered an urgent listing and consented to form a new bench to hear the petitions.Bano was five months pregnant and 21 years old when she was gang-raped in 2002 while fleeing the violence that broke out in Gujarat following the burning of the Godhra train. Her three-year-old daughter was among the seven members of her family who perished.</p>
<p>On January 4, this year, a bench consisting of Justices Ajay Rastogi and Bela M. Trivedi heard Bano&#8217;s petition, but then recused themselves without providing a reason.Bano petitioned the apex court in November, shortly after all eleven convicts were granted clemency by the Gujarat government and released on August 15 of last year, contesting their &#8220;premature&#8221; release and claiming it &#8220;shook the conscience of society.&#8221;</p>
<p>According to a PTI report, Bano stated in her pending writ petition that the state government had issued a &#8220;mechanical order&#8221; in complete disregard of the Supreme Court&#8217;s legal requirements. &#8220;The mass premature release of convicts in the much-discussed Bilkis Bano case has shaken the social conscience and sparked a number of protests across the country,&#8221; she said.</p>
<p>The petition stated, &#8220;The present writ petition challenges the state/central government&#8217;s decision to grant all 11 convicts clemency and release them prematurely for one of the most heinous crimes of extreme inhuman violence and brutality.&#8221;&#8221;When the country was celebrating its 76th Independence Day, all of the prisoners were released early, garlanded, and congratulated in full public view, and sweets were distributed,&#8221; it continued.</p>
<p>Subhashini Ali, Revati Laul, an independent journalist, Roop Rekha Verma, the former Vice-Chancellor of Lucknow University, and Mahua Moitra, an MP for the TMC, also filed PILs opposing the release of the convicts.</p>

<p>In January 2008, a special CBI court in Mumbai sentenced the convicted of gang-raping Bano and murdering seven members of her family to life in prison. Both the Bombay High Court and the Supreme Court subsequently upheld their conviction.</p>
